Review:  Moonlight on Nightingale Way by Samantha Young

Review: Moonlight on Nightingale Way by Samantha Young

Posted June 2, 2015 by Lucy D in Book Reviews, Contemporary, New Adult / 0 Comments

Moonlight is the last in the On Dublin Street series. As a final story, it was a wonderful tale of Shannon’s brother, Logan MacLeod, recently released from prison. Logan went to jail for beating up Shannon’s ex-friend after he attacked Shannon. We know what a good man he is for what he has done to support Shannon over the years, but two years in prison has Logan doubting his self-worth. It is new neighbor Grace who helps remind Logan what a good man he truly is.

Review:  A Sorceress of His Own by Dianne Duvall

Review: A Sorceress of His Own by Dianne Duvall

Posted May 28, 2015 by Lucy D in Book Reviews, Paranormal Romance / 4 Comments

This series is a prequel to Dianne’s popular Immortal Guardian series. This is the introduction of the gifted ones. They have advanced DNA and special abilities such as reading thoughts, healing with their hands or seeing the future. It is their descendants who will someday become the Immortal Guardians. It is much different from her current series, but just as enjoyable.
